Abstract
⺠Bitumen was partially oxidized in supercritical water for selective CO formation. ⺠The bitumen - supercritical water - air system consisted of two phases. ⺠The CO selectivity increased and the amount of total gas tended to decrease with increasing water/oil ratio. ⺠The increase in air pressure increased the amount of CO and CO2 and decreased the CO selectivity. ⺠Temperature, water/oil ratio and air pressure were important factors to govern partial oxidation of bitumen.
